- 博客(14)
- 收藏
- 关注
原创 map中包含key则删除
if (paramMap.containsKey("LogicCheckRptTmpId")){ paramMap.keySet().removeIf(s -> s.equals("LogicCheckRptTmpId"));}旧式写法-迭代器删除Iterator<String> iter = map.keySet().iterator();while(iter.hasNext()){ if(iter.next().equals("sss")){ .
2022-03-21 18:21:41
300
原创 分数排名1
select score,dense_rank() over(order by score desc) as 'rank'from Scoresrow_number():依次递增排名,无重复排名rank():相同分数有重复排名,但是重复后下一个人按照实际排名dense_rank():分数一致排名一致,分数不一致排名+1NTILE(4):分组排名,里面的数字是几,最多排名就是几,里面的数字是4,最多的排名就是41.rank() over:排名相同的两名是并列,但是占两个名次,1 1 3 4 .
2022-03-17 18:45:59
132
原创 第二高的薪水
1.使用子查询和 LIMIT 子句SELECT (SELECT DISTINCT Salary FROM Employee ORDER BY Salary DESC LIMIT 1 OFFSET 1) AS SecondHighestSalarydistinct对相同工资去重imit X 表示读取X个数据limit X,Y 中X表示跳过X个数据,读取Y个数据limit X offse...
2022-03-15 14:44:22
103
原创 JAVA数据转换
1、json数组转list对象List<User> list = JSONObject.parseArray(jsonArray, User.class);2、json字符串转对象User user = JSON.parseObject(jsonString, User.class);
2022-03-09 16:49:02
1273
原创 ORA-00923: FROM keyword not found where expected
1,表中列名的定义是否错用了关键字2,查询语句列名是否与表定义列表不匹配
2022-03-07 10:14:05
248
原创 list的一些操作
1、subList()截取List<Object> list = new ArrayList<>();List<Object> subList = list.subList(0, 3);subList(0, 3)取得的是下标为0到2的元素,不包含下标为3的元素2、addAll()合并List<Object> a = new ArrayList<>();List<Object> b = new ArrayList&
2022-02-10 15:28:38
768
原创 js数组传参
var rows = grid.getSelectedRows();var ids = new Array();for(var j = 0; j < rows.length; j++) { ids.push(rows[j].id);}传参:data : { "ids" : JSON.stringify(ids)},java接收“:List<String> idList = JSONObject.parseArray(ids, String...
2021-11-24 14:28:02
1426
原创 JAVA8和JAVA7的区别
一.接口提供默认方法default和静态方法static为什么?扩展接口方法而又不强制实现类实现,往现存接口中添加新的方法,不强制那些实现了该接口的类也同时实现这个新加的方法。默认方法和抽象方法之间的区别:1.在接口中抽象方法需要实现,而默认方法不需要,如果接口中有默认方法,实现类将默认继承这个默认方法2.静态方法属于接口本身,不被实现类所继承;默认方法可以被接口的实现类继承或者覆写3.使用方式默认方法:接口默认方法impl.method。而当被覆盖后,接口中的默认方法调用为:接
2021-10-28 17:02:12
455
原创 函数
短小,20行封顶最佳每个函数只做一件事,而且每个函数都依序把你带到下一函数,做了同一抽象层次下的事。要判断函数是否不止做了一件事,就是看是否能再拆出一个函数,
2021-06-29 09:12:46
134
1
原创 整洁代码
勒布朗法则:稍后等于永不整洁的代码只做一件事,就事论事,没有犹豫或不必要的细节不要重复代码,只做一件事,包括尽可能少的实体,比如类,方法,函数等,专为解决那个问题而存在让营地比你来时更干净,每次修改都比之前干净...
2021-06-29 09:02:50
90
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人